Summer Sun Safety
Living on the beautiful Eastern Shore, our residents are more vulnerable to extreme heat.
Here are some tips for keeping cool this summer:
● Limit your outdoor activity, especially midday (10 a.m. - 4 p.m.) when the sun is hottest.
● Drink more water than usual and don’t wait until you’re thirsty to drink more. Muscle cramping may be an early sign of heat-related illness.
● Wear loose, lightweight, light-colored clothing.
● Always use sunscreen of SPF 15 or higher.
● Check on a friend or neighbor and have someone do the same for you.
● Never leave children or pets in cars.
● Keep humidity in mind - When the humidity is high, sweat won’t evaporate as quickly. This keeps your body from releasing heat as fast as it may need to.
Remember, those who are at highest risk include people 65 and older, children younger than two, and people with chronic diseases. Take these measures to stay cool, hydrated, and healthy this summer.
Free Adult Vaccines Available Through Maryland Vaccine Program
Vaccines are an important way to protect yourself, your family, and your community from a range of infectious diseases. The Maryland Vaccine Program (MVP) is a new initiative that ensures all Marylanders have access to life-saving immunizations.
The MVP provides vaccines free-of-charge to adults aged 19 years and older who are:
● Uninsured individuals who do not have health insurance.
● Underinsured individuals who have health insurance but still face barriers to immunization (e.g., insurance doesn’t cover vaccines or there is a high copay for vaccines)
The MVP provides vaccines recommended by the American Academy of Family Physicians (AAFP) which includes HPV, Meningococcal, MMR (Measles, Mumps, Rubella), Influenza, COVID-19 vaccines, and more. Vaccines are currently available at the Worcester County Health Department. Call
410-632-1100
opt. 4 to make your appointment today.
Bring the family together with Worcester Health’s Strengthening Families Program
This free 9-week Program is for the whole family! Parents and guardians (with children aged 7 to 17) will learn to improve behaviors in their children by using positive attention and rewards, clear communication, effective discipline, age appropriate substance abuse education, problem solving and limit setting. Children get to learn effective communication, understanding of feelings, social and problem solving skills, how to resist peer pressure, age appropriate consequences of substance use, and following household rules.
